To date, DAVE and TONY have lived and worked in Lisbon, Berlin, London, and in the USA.
DAVE was born and raised in the UK - his father was Ukrainian, a Prisoner of War who naturalised to become British in 1962; his mother was British. DAVE received his BA in Fine Art from Goldsmiths, University of London (1989-1992), MA in Fine Art from Chelsea College of Arts, UAL London (2007-2008). DAVE has shown work extensively over the years. DAVE was formerly represented by September Gallery in Berlin, holding a solo show called “Irutturi” (2010) and showing at Art Cologne and Artforum Berlin. DAVE was also formerly represented by Works Projects in Bristol UK, holding a solo show called “GLEN” (2012). DAVE had a solo show at The Black Mariah in Cork Ireland entitled “Bodysuit Opening Ceremony” (2010), and one called “Peter Wahowitz | American Bodies” (2012) in Salford Manchester - the product of an Artist Residency at Islington Mill. DAVE has shown work in numerous group shows internationally, including at Hauser and Wirth Somerset, Transition Gallery, Hackney Picture House, Quare Gallery, Master Piper Gallery, David Roberts Art Foundation, The Bussey Building, The Surgery in London, and The International Anthony Burgess Foundation in Manchester, Abandon Normal Devices Festival in Preston, The Black Mariah in Dublin Ireland. In Germany, at Kühlhaus, Galerie Vincenz Sala, September Gallery and Knoth and Krüger Gallery in Berlin and Zanderkasten Gallery in Dresden.
TONY was born in South Africa to an Italian immigrant father and South African mother. TONY completed his BA in Architecture in South Africa (1990-1995). In 1995, TONY moved to London, where he completed his MA in Fashion at Central St Martins UAL (1998-2000). For years, he worked in the Design and Fashion industries, holding numerous related bi-seasonal shows in London and showing work internationally in Berlin, Tokyo, Paris, Milan, and the Middle East. TONY has worked as Show, Production, and Graphics/Video/Music Director for numerous public shows. TONY has been published in books by Hywel Davies and Laird Borrelli, and numerous art and design publications. TONY has been a former Artist-in-Residence at London College of Fashion and the Victoria and Albert Museum London (2006), Visiting Artist at the School of the Art Institute of Chicago (2011). Adjacent to his practice, TONY worked extensively in Higher Education - in the USA at School of the Art Institute of Chicago IL and RISD Providence RI, in Germany at Weissensee and University of the Arts UdK in Berlin, and University of Applied Sciences in Trier, and in UK at University of the Creative Arts, Rochester, LCF, CSM, universities in Bristol, Birmingham and several international schools. TONY began to work with AR, Wearables, FashionTech and gaming software after winning a Fashion Fusion Award in Berlin (2016-2017).
DAVE and TONY met in Brixton, London, in 1995, and have been partners ever since. They moved from London to Berlin in 2007 and were formally married in NYC in 2018. In December 2020, with Brexit looming and the global pandemic still ongoing, they took the wrong decision to move to Italy. Following a traumatic and transformative experience there, they escaped to Lisbon, Portugal, where they have been ever since. Although having collaborated frequently in the past, 'DAVE AND TONY' was born in 2021, driven by a shared desire to express their common purpose and articulate the deeper meaning of their connection.
